Tranquil Oasis Fountain Landscape Ideas for Your Garden
Laura May 29, 2024 ArticleCreating a Serene Escape: Fountain Landscape Ideas
Transforming your garden into a tranquil oasis requires careful planning and thoughtful design choices. Incorporating a fountain into your landscape can add a sense of serenity and relaxation, turning your outdoor space into a peaceful retreat where you can unwind and connect with nature.
Choosing the Right Fountain Design
When selecting a fountain for your garden, consider the overall style and aesthetic you want to achieve. There are various fountain designs to choose from, including tiered fountains, wall fountains, and modern sculptures. Choose a design that complements the architecture of your home and the surrounding landscape, creating a cohesive and harmonious look.
Selecting the Perfect Location
The location of your fountain is crucial to its overall impact in your garden. Place the fountain in a central or focal point of your garden, such as at the end of a pathway or in the center of a flowerbed. This will draw the eye and create a sense of balance and symmetry in your landscape. Additionally, consider the sound of the fountain – placing it near a seating area will allow you to enjoy the soothing sound of flowing water as you relax outdoors.
Creating a Natural Setting
To enhance the tranquil atmosphere of your fountain landscape, surround it with lush greenery and colorful flowers. Planting trees, shrubs, and perennials around the fountain will soften its edges and create a naturalistic setting. Consider using plants with varying heights and textures to add visual interest and depth to the landscape, creating a vibrant and inviting space.
Adding Lighting for Ambiance
Illuminate your fountain landscape with strategically placed lighting to enhance its beauty, especially in the evening hours. LED spotlights can be used to highlight the fountain itself, while pathway lights can guide visitors through the garden. Consider incorporating underwater lights into the fountain basin to create a mesmerizing effect and illuminate the flowing water at night.
Incorporating Water Plants
Enhance the beauty of your fountain landscape by incorporating water plants such as water lilies, lotus flowers, and water irises into the design. These plants not only add visual interest and color to the landscape but also help to oxygenate the water and maintain a healthy ecosystem within the fountain. Choose plants that are suited to the size and depth of your fountain and ensure proper maintenance to keep them thriving.
Creating a Relaxing Atmosphere
To truly create a tranquil oasis in your garden, incorporate elements that promote relaxation and mindfulness. Add comfortable seating areas near the fountain where you can sit and unwind, surrounded by the sights and sounds of nature. Consider adding features such as wind chimes, bird feeders, or a small meditation garden to enhance the peaceful ambiance and encourage moments of reflection and contemplation.

Elevating Your Exterior: Front Garden Fence Ideas
When it comes to enhancing the curb appeal of your home, the front garden fence plays a crucial role. It not only provides security and privacy but also serves as a welcoming statement to visitors. Let’s explore some charming front garden fence ideas to boost the curb appeal of your property and make a lasting impression.
Classic Wooden Fencing: Timeless Charm
Wooden fences exude a timeless charm that never goes out of style. Opt for classic picket fences for a quaint and inviting look, or choose horizontal slat fences for a modern twist. Cedar, pine, and redwood are popular wood choices known for their durability and natural beauty. Enhance the warmth of wood with a fresh coat of paint or stain to match your home’s exterior color scheme.
Wrought Iron Elegance: Sophisticated Appeal
For a touch of sophistication and elegance, consider wrought iron fencing for your front garden. Intricate designs and decorative motifs add visual interest and architectural flair to your property. Wrought iron fences are not only durable and low-maintenance but also allow for creativity in design, whether you prefer traditional scrolls or contemporary geometric patterns.
Vinyl Versatility: Durability with Style
Vinyl fencing offers the perfect blend of durability and style, making it an excellent choice for front garden fences. Available in various colors and designs, vinyl fences are resistant to rot, fading, and weathering, making them ideal for homes in all climates. Choose from privacy fences, lattice panels, or decorative accents to enhance the aesthetic appeal of your front yard.
Natural Beauty: Living Garden Fences
Living garden fences, such as hedges or shrubs, add natural beauty and greenery to your front yard while providing privacy and security. Boxwood, privet, and yew are popular choices for creating dense, evergreen hedges that can be trimmed into formal shapes or left to grow naturally. Consider incorporating flowering shrubs or climbing vines for added color and texture.
Metal Mesh: Modern Minimalism
For a contemporary and minimalist look, metal mesh fencing offers a sleek and stylish solution. Mesh panels made of steel or aluminum provide security and visibility without obstructing views of your front garden. Choose from different mesh patterns and finishes to complement your home’s architectural style and create a cohesive look.
Bamboo Beauty: Eco-Friendly Elegance
Bamboo fencing adds an eco-friendly and exotic touch to your front garden while creating a sense of privacy and tranquility. Bamboo is a sustainable and renewable material that grows quickly, making it an environmentally conscious choice for fencing. Whether used as panels, screens, or rolled fencing, bamboo adds warmth and texture to your outdoor space.
Mix and Match: Eclectic Charm
For a truly unique and eclectic front garden fence, consider mixing and matching different materials, textures, and styles. Combine wood with metal accents, incorporate decorative tiles or mosaic patterns, or add unexpected elements such as salvaged doors or repurposed materials. Embrace your creativity to design a front garden fence that reflects your personality and adds charm to your home.
